On 14/03/2005, the Supreme Court dismissed the special leave petition filed by Abad Hussain and another against the Jharkhand High Court's decision dated 20/12/2004. The Court granted liberty to the petitioners to renew their prayers for suspension of sentence and bail before the High Court after the lapse of a reasonable period of time.
